Whatever is done after submitting the eAPR - say new employment, new education, new travel -- any such activity be it in the home country or a different country, new stamps on the passport, marriage does that all affect the Express Entry processing, and does that need to be continually updated on the express entry portal?
Are there any activities that one is forbidden to do after submitting the eAPR till one gets his/her PR, as it might interfere with the PR Processing?

If you move to a new city/country, if your family composition changes, or if you renew your passport, then you need to inform IRCC.
Okay, how do I do that? Is that by Email? Does it effect the PR processing?

By raising a webform. The PR processing depends on what kind of change you are reporting.
